After much frustration with a bluetooth adapter, I was unable to pair a single device and "Open Settings" had no effect. Nothing I tried worked; either the drivers themselves were flawed or a small number of "Bluetooth Peripheral Devices" just did not recognize the official manufacturer drivers. In the end, it was all quite straightforward. Solution: We enter "Services" in Start or navigate to it via Control Panel > All Control Panel Items > Administrative Tools > Services. We locate a service with the helpful name "Bluetooth Support Service," activate it, and schedule it to launch immediately. The parameters then become available, and the hardware can be linked:)
